Enchilada-Inspired Cheesy Aubergine Bake
This Enchilada-Inspired Cheesy Aubergine Bake is a delightful twist on traditional enchiladas, offering a delicious, hearty meal that's both flavorful and healthy. The star ingredient, eggplant, is baked to perfection and layered with a savory tomato and chili sauce featuring green onions and black olives. Topped with reduced-fat cheddar cheese, this dish melts into a creamy, cheesy goodness that's irresistible! Perfect for a cozy family dinner or a gathering with friends, it pairs beautifully with a fresh, undressed salad and, if you'd like, a dollop of sour cream for added creaminess. Whether you keep it simple or spice it up with jalapeรฑos or add extra protein, this dish is versatile enough to satisfy any craving. Enjoy the mix of textures and flavors in every bite!

Enchilada-Inspired Cheesy Aubergine Bake instructions

Ingredients

Eggplants 1 1/2-2 lbs (unpeeled and cut into 1/2 inch slices)
Tomato sauce 15 ounces
Diced mild green chilies 4 ounces
Green onion 1/2 cup (sliced)
Ground cumin 1/2 teaspoon
Garlic powder 1/2 teaspoon
Sliced black olives 2 1/4 ounces (drained)
Reduced-fat cheddar cheese 6 ounces (shredded (about 1 1/2 cups))
Cooking spray

Instructions

1
Preheat your oven to 450ยฐF (230ยฐC).
2
Prepare a baking sheet by spraying it lightly with cooking spray.
3
Arrange the eggplant slices on the prepared baking sheet in a single layer and spray the tops with additional cooking spray. Bake for 15 to 25 minutes, or until the slices are soft when pressed.
4
While the eggplant is baking, prepare the sauce: In a small pot, combine the tomato sauce, diced mild green chilies, sliced green onions, ground cumin, garlic powder, and drained black olives. Bring the mixture to a simmer over medium heat, then reduce to medium-low and simmer uncovered for 10 minutes.
5
Once the eggplant is done, lower the oven temperature to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C).
6
In a shallow 1 1/2 quart baking dish, arrange half of the baked eggplant slices in a single layer. Spoon half of the prepared sauce over the eggplant, then sprinkle with half of the shredded cheese. Repeat the layers, finishing with the remaining cheese on top.
7
Bake the entire dish in the oven at 350ยฐF (175ยฐC) for about 30 minutes, or until it is heated through and bubbly.
8
If desired, top with sour cream before serving.
